11-Year-Old 'Sick of Reading About White Boys and Dogs' Launches #1000BlackGirlBooks

http://jezebel.com/11-year-old-sick-of-reading-about-white-boys-and-dogs-l-1755021888

Marley Dias is an 11-year-old New Jersey resident who’s spent more time giving back to her community in her brief time on this planet than most of us will spend in a lifetime. She’s received a grant from Disney, traveled to Ghana to help feed orphans, and now—in her latest act of altruism—she’s rounding up children’s books that feature black female leads so that she and her peers have more fictional characters to look up to.

The project, titled #1000BlackGirlBooks, started when Marley complained to her mother about reading too many books about white male protagonists in school.

From the Philly Voice:
“I told her I was sick of reading about white boys and dogs,” Dias said, pointing specifically to “Where the Red Fern Grows” and the “Shiloh” series. “‘What are you going to do about it?’ [my mom] asked. And I told her I was going to start a book drive, and a specific book drive, where black girls are the main characters in the book and not background characters or minor characters.”

Marley is looking to collect 1000 books featuring black female protagonists by February 1. She is nearly halfway to her goal.

4. A Partial List:
Wed Jan 27, 2016, 04:11 PM
Jan 2016

Brown Girl Dreaming by Jacqueline Woodson
One Crazy Summer by Rita Williams-Garcia
P.S. Be Eleven by Rita Williams-Garcia
Gone Crazy in Alabama by Rita Williams-Garcia
A Long Walk to Water: Based on a True Story by Linda Sue Park

There are some others, but more are needed. Please add to the list! Thanks.
